Abstract

This paper presents a fault diagnosis method for a neutral point clamped (NPC) three-level inverter using BP neural network. As the fault mode occurring in one single power device has got a lot of attention, this paper focuses on the study of atypical faults. All possible open-circuit failures arising from two power devices on two cross bridge arms (atypical faults) are considered. Output voltages are used as measurement to classify the fault modes. The fault features are extracted from the output voltages by Fourier transform method and then used as the inputs of BP neural network which identifies the fault modes. Simulation results prove the feasibility of the diagnostic method and its good classification performance.
